SECTION 2 - INSTALLATION

F. Initially Clean the Griddle

1.Clean the rust preventive material from the griddle surface with a non-flammable grease solvent.

2.Wash the griddle with warm water and a mild detergent.

3.Rinse with a damp cloth and wipe dry.

G.Test the Installation, refer to Figure 3-2

NOTE: The griddle must be initially cleaned as directed in Step F before completion of Step G.

1.Turn all rocker On/Off switches to the "Off" position.

2.Turn all thermostat control knobs to the lowest temperature setting.

3.Turn the main power disconnect switch to "ON".

4.Turn "On" the On/Off switch located at the left end of the griddle. Then turn the corresponding left thermostat control knob to 200°F (93°C) and check that heating light located below control knob illuminates. Wait a few minutes and check to see if the left section of the griddle has heated. Then wait a few more minutes and check that the heating light goes off when the section of the griddle reaches set temperature. Turn the temperature control knob back to its lowest position and turn the On/Off Switch back to "Off".

5.Move to the next rocker On/Off switch and thermostat control knob and repeat Step 4. Continue until the entire griddle has been tested.
